Abstract

A system for detecting a moving object, having: a radar device for receiving at least one signal reflected by the object under at least one angle; and a processing unit for ascertaining at least one relative velocity and at least one angle for each ascertained relative velocity between the radar device and the object; a micro-Doppler analysis for the signals received from the object being able to be performed with the processing unit; the micro-Doppler analysis being performed based on angles determined for the received signals; and a type of the object being ascertainable with the performed micro-Doppler analysis.
